メインコンテンツへスキップ

Excelでセルをランダムに選択するにはどうすればよいですか?

ワークシートに値の列(A1:A15)があり、それらの5つのランダムなセルを選択する必要があるとすると、これにどのように対処できますか? この記事では、Excelでセルをランダムに選択するためのいくつかの秘訣を紹介します。

数式を使用して列からランダムにセルを選択します

ユーザー定義関数(UDF)を使用して列からセルをランダムに選択します

Kutools forExcelを使用して範囲からセルをランダムに選択します 良いアイデア3


矢印青い右バブル 数式を使用して列からランダムにセルを選択します

次のスクリーンショットが示すように、A1からA15までの範囲のデータがあります。 ボーダー > インデックス 数式は、ランダムセルを新しい列に表示するのに役立ちます。 次のようにしてください。

doc-select-cells-randomly1

1. B1などの隣接するセルに、数式を入力します = RAND()、 を押して 入力します キーを押してから、数式をセルB15にコピーします。 そして、ランダムな値はセルで埋められます。 スクリーンショットを参照してください:
doc-select-cells-randomly2

2.次に、上の次のセル(この場合はセルC1)に、数式を入力します =INDEX($A$1:$A$15,RANK(B1,$B$1:$B$15)).
doc-select-cells-randomly3

3.次にを押します 入力します キーを押してセルC1を選択し、塗りつぶしハンドルをドラッグして、必要な数のセルをカバーします。 また、範囲A5:A1のランダムな15つのセルが列Cに表示されています。スクリーンショットを参照してください。
doc-select-cells-randomly4


Excelの選択範囲からセル/行/列をランダムにすばやく並べ替えまたは選択します

ランダムにExcelのソート範囲のKutools セル、列、または行ごとにランダムにデータをすばやく並べ替えたり選択したりできます。 クリックすると、全機能を備えた 30 日間の無料トライアルが可能です。
ドキュメントはランダムに並べ替えます
ドキュメントはランダムに選択します
 
 Kutools for Excel:300を超える便利なExcelアドインがあり、30日以内に制限なしで無料で試すことができます。

矢印青い右バブル ユーザー定義関数(UDF)を使用して列からセルをランダムに選択します

次のVBAコードは、必要なランダムセルを表示するのにも役立ちます。

1。 クリック Developer > ビジュアルベーシック、新しいです アプリケーション用のMicrosoftVisual Basic ウィンドウが表示されたら、をクリックします インセット > モジュール、次の関数をに入力します モジュール:

Function RandomSelection(aRng As Range)
'Update20131113
Dim index As Integer
Randomize
index = Int(aRng.Count * Rnd + 1)
RandomSelection = aRng.Cells(index).Value
End Function

2.次に、モジュールウィンドウを閉じて、この関数に入ります。 = RandomSelection($ A $ 1:$ A $ 15) セルB1内。 スクリーンショットを参照してください:
doc-select-cells-randomly5

3。 押す 入力します キーを押すと、A1:A15のランダムな値が列Bに表示されます。次に、塗りつぶしハンドルをドラッグして、必要な数のセルをカバーします。doc-select-cells-randomly6

上記のXNUMXつの方法では、ランダムなセル値を新しい列に表示できます。これらは単一の列範囲にのみ適用され、セルの範囲には機能しません。 Kutools for Excelの[範囲のランダムに並べ替え]ツールを使用すると、元の範囲のセルをランダムに選択できます。


矢印青い右バブル Kutools forExcelを使用して範囲からセルをランダムに選択します

Kutools for Excel, 以上で 300 便利な機能は、あなたの仕事をより簡単にします。 

後の 無料インストール Kutools for Excel、以下のようにしてください:

1.使用する範囲を選択します。

2.をクリックしてユーティリティを適用します クツール > レンジ > 範囲をランダムに並べ替え/選択、スクリーンショットを参照してください:
docランダムに選択1

3。 の中に 範囲をランダムに並べ替え/選択 ダイアログボックスで、をクリックします。 選択 ボタンをクリックし、選択するセルの数を入力して、 タイプを選択 あなたが必要です。 次に、をクリックします OK or 適用されます。 スクリーンショットを参照してください:

選択した範囲からランダムに10個のセルを選択します
docランダムに選択2

選択した範囲からランダムに5行を選択します
docランダムに選択3

選択した範囲からランダムな4列を選択します
docランダムに選択4

ランダムセルを選択するために高度な、 範囲をランダムに並べ替える of Kutools for Excel 範囲全体、各行、各列などでデータをランダムに並べ替えることができます。
docランダムに選択5

矢印青い右バブル 範囲内のデータをランダムに選択または並べ替える


セルの範囲に重複することなくランダムデータを簡単に挿入

ランダムで重複する整数、日付、時刻、文字列、さらにはカスタムリストをセルの範囲に挿入したい場合は、フォーラムを覚えるのが難しいかもしれません。 だが ExcelのInserランダムデータ用のKutools これらのジョブを可能な限り簡単にすばやく処理できます。 クリックすると全機能が表示され、30 日間の無料トライアルが可能です。
docはランダムデータを挿入します
 
Kutools for Excel:300を超える便利なExcelアドインがあり、30日以内に制限なしで無料で試すことができます。

関連記事:

列または範囲内のセルをランダムに並べ替える

最高のオフィス生産性向上ツール

人気の機能: 重複を検索、強調表示、または識別する   |  空白行を削除する   |  データを失わずに列またはセルを結合する   |   数式なしのラウンド ...
スーパールックアップ: 複数の基準の VLookup    複数の値の VLookup  |   複数のシートにわたる VLookup   |   ファジールックアップ ....
詳細ドロップダウン リスト: ドロップダウンリストを素早く作成する   |  依存関係のドロップダウン リスト   |  複数選択のドロップダウンリスト ....
列マネージャー: 特定の数の列を追加する  |  列の移動  |  Toggle 非表示列の表示ステータス  |  範囲と列の比較 ...
注目の機能: グリッドフォーカス   |  デザインビュー   |   ビッグフォーミュラバー    ワークブックとシートマネージャー   |  リソースライブラリ (自動テキスト)   |  日付ピッカー   |  ワークシートを組み合わせる   |  セルの暗号化/復号化    リストごとにメールを送信する   |  スーパーフィルター   |   特殊フィルター (太字/斜体/取り消し線をフィルター...) ...
上位 15 のツールセット12 テキスト 工具 (テキストを追加, 文字を削除する、...)   |   50+ チャート 種類 (ガントチャート、...)   |   40+ 実用的 (誕生日に基づいて年齢を計算する、...)   |   19 挿入 工具 (QRコードを挿入, パスから画像を挿入、...)   |   12 変換 工具 (数字から言葉へ, 通貨の換算、...)   |   7 マージ&スプリット 工具 (高度な結合行, 分割セル、...)   |   ... もっと

Kutools for Excel で Excel スキルを強化し、これまでにない効率を体験してください。 Kutools for Excelは、生産性を向上させ、時間を節約するための300以上の高度な機能を提供します。  最も必要な機能を入手するにはここをクリックしてください...

kteタブ201905


Officeタブは、タブ付きのインターフェイスをOfficeにもたらし、作​​業をはるかに簡単にします

  • Word、Excel、PowerPointでタブ付きの編集と読み取りを有効にする、パブリッシャー、アクセス、Visioおよびプロジェクト。
  • 新しいウィンドウではなく、同じウィンドウの新しいタブで複数のドキュメントを開いて作成します。
  • 生産性を 50% 向上させ、毎日何百回もマウス クリックを減らすことができます!
Comments (15)
No ratings yet. Be the first to rate!
This comment was minimized by the moderator on the site
Как же я намучился, пока подбирал эту же формулу для русскоязычного Excel! Вот она: =ИНДЕКС(A:A;РАНГ(B1;B:B;1))
This comment was minimized by the moderator on the site
Very useful, but the format of the cells has been changed and also its showing few duplicate values. Please tell me how to get it solved.
This comment was minimized by the moderator on the site
Hi I am looking to build a grid with names on the left and dates (weeks) across the top. I then need to have a function that fills in random X's on particular weeks for all names. Is this possible
This comment was minimized by the moderator on the site
This one is just awesome! Exactly what I needed! Thanks!
This comment was minimized by the moderator on the site
How to select perecent of cells randomly and replace by a specific number?
This comment was minimized by the moderator on the site
Thanks. Was a great and quick help.
This comment was minimized by the moderator on the site
Thanks. Really was a great and quick help.
This comment was minimized by the moderator on the site
Wow!!! This is really amazing! Thanks a lot for these great tricks.
This comment was minimized by the moderator on the site
Great info, however on my "randomly selected cells" there are duplicates... how can I prevent that from happening? I need the random selection to return unique cells
This comment was minimized by the moderator on the site
to do this you will need to set up a random non repeating set of numbers I used this website to do it: http://support.microsoft.com/kb/213290
This comment was minimized by the moderator on the site
I would like to random select a document with 500 items. I want to select 10 percent. There are four columns in that document. Is there a way to do this?
There are no comments posted here yet
Load More
Please leave your comments in English
Posting as Guest
×
Rate this post:
0   Characters
Suggested Locations